Lindsey Schrott joined the ACES team in 2021 after working at Coppin State University. She received an MA from Emerson College in 2009 and is currently pursuing a PhD in Educational Theory and Policy at Penn State University. In addition to education research, her professional experiences include program coordination and assessment, grants management, student advising, and student instruction.
